Data from UIE is transferred and populated into a CDB staging database. To get this data into the BMC Continuous Optimization Database, you must:

  • Configure the BMC Continuous Optimization for MainframesETL task to pull data from the CDB staging database and populate the data warehouse
  • Run the ETL task manually to prepare various system parameters
  • Schedule the ETL task to run automatically to keep the data warehouse updated with the latest information
